Output 6e7a26a146db827f81d223496f55391932056a665c634d20c957a991db0759f0:0

value
1006351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ea2eac5cb83c4aebd65fe977223060361496c3ee OP_EQUALVERIFY OP_CHECKSIG
address
1NMF2oiBTurDey81AvCvxkTxtg864QrEZv
transaction
6e7a26a146db827f81d223496f55391932056a665c634d20c957a991db0759f0
confirmations
569814
spent
true